Frequently Asked Questions about Oakbrook Terrace
How much are Studio apartments in Oakbrook Terrace?
There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in Oakbrook Terrace with rent ranges from $1,350 to $2,200 with an average price of $1,613.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Oakbrook Terrace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Oakbrook Terrace ranges from $1,100 to $9,398 with an average monthly rent of $2,384.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Oakbrook Terrace c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Oakbrook Terrace range from $1,459 to $10,021.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,955.
How expensive are Oakbrook Terrace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Oakbrook Terrace on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,504 to $7,044 - averaging $4,183 for the location.
